The rise of “car culture” in travel is no accident. For US-based travelers, especially millennials and Gen Z, renting a vehicle offers control over itinerary timing, comfort, and spontaneity. Unlike pre-arranged tours, a rental car lets explorers adjust plans on the go—vital when discovering local favorites like quiet corniche views, vibrant farmers’ markets, or secluded coastal trails. Digital platforms now make this seamless: easy online bookings, transparent pricing, and 24/7 access fit perfectly with mobile-first behavior.
Beginner or seasoned travelers alike appreciate this flexibility. With GPS-assisted routing and real-time traffic updates, navigation is intuitive. Digital rentals often include multilingual support and flexible pickup/drop-off points, enhancing convenience. This blend of ease, independence, and discovery makes the car more than just transport—it becomes the foundation of memorable exploration.
